Raleigh, N.C. — Authorities are investigating a shooting that happened Tuesday afternoon at a Raleigh apartment complex.
Police responded shortly before 4 p.m. to the 4200 block of Middle Oaks Drive at The Gardens at Wynslow Park, where they found Christopher M. Wheeler, 34. He was transported to WakeMed with injuries that did not appear to be life-threatening.
Further details about the shooting weren't available, but a police spokesman said it did not appear to be a random act.
